The apartment has two security doors, where the first leads to a small hall with a wardrobe that can be used as a wardrobe or as a small storage room to put sunbeds and parasols in after the beach time.Torrevieja is a coastal town located in the province of Alicante, on the southeastern coast of Spain.

It is part of the Valencian Community and is situated on the Costa Blanca, along the Mediterranean Sea.Location: Torrevieja is situated between the cities of Alicante and Murcia, making it a popular destination for both tourists and expatriates.Climate: The town has a Mediterranean climate with hot summers and mild winters.

It is known for its salt lakes, which contribute to the microclimate and are believed to have health benefits.Economy: Traditionally, Torrevieja\'s economy has been centered around fishing and salt production. In recent years, however, tourism and the expatriate community have become significant contributors to the local economy.Tourism: Torrevieja attracts tourists with its sandy beaches, vibrant nightlife, and a variety of cultural and recreational activities.

The town has a waterfront promenade, a marina, and several parks.Salt Lakes: The town is known for its salt lakes, including the Laguna Salada de la Mata and the Laguna Salada de Torrevieja. These lakes are pinkish in color due to the presence of certain microorganisms and are a unique feature of the area.Expatriate Community: Torrevieja has a sizable expatriate community, with many foreigners, particularly from Northern European countries, choosing to live in the area, either seasonally or year-round.Cultural Attractions: The town has various cultural attractions, including museums, theaters, and festivals.

The Habaneras and Polyphony International Contest is a renowned event held in Torrevieja, featuring choral music.Transportation: The town is well-connected by road, with the AP-7 motorway providing easy access. The nearest airports are Alicante-Elche Airport and Murcia-Corvera Airport.

The exchange rate on the day you make an offer on your property in Spain will not be the same as the rate you pay when you complete on your purchase, as currency markets move constantly. Any large rate movements may take it beyond your price range as the chart above illustrates the fluctuation and how much extra your property could have cost you.

The best way to avoid this significant risk is to plan your budget and currency strategy with an experienced currency specialist. They have been known to save you up to 4% compared to many high street banks, £4,000 for every £100,000, which soon adds up. They will also keep you up to date on market movements, help you set a rate in advance with a product called a Forward Contract - so you know exactly what you will pay for your property in sterling.
